Description:

Fifteen differentially expressed microRNAs were identified with concordant fold-changes by microarray and RT-qPCR analyses. Ten microRNAs (hsa-miR-16, hsa-miR-31, hsa-miR-125b, hsa-miR-145, hsa-miR-149, hsa-miR-181b, hsa-miR-184, hsa-miR-205, hsa-miR-221, hsa-miR-222) were down-regulated and five miRNAs (hsa-miR-96, hsa-miR-182, hsa-miR-182*, hsa-miR-183, hsa-375) were up-regulated. Expression of five microRNAs correlated with Gleason score or pathological tumour stage. Already two microRNAs classified up to 84% of malignant and non-malignant samples correctly. Expression of hsa-miR-96 was associated with cancer recurrence after radical prostatectomy and that prognostic information was confirmed by an independent tumour sample set from 79 patients. That was shown with hsa-miR-96 and the Gleason score as final variables in the Cox models build in the two patient sets investigated. Thus, differential microRNAs in prostate cancer are useful diagnostic and prognostic indicators. The presented study provides a solid basis for further functional analyses of miRNAs in prostate cancer.
